Zion Williamson scores 28, closes out Pelicans' 107-100 win over the Bucks

NEW ORLEANS — Zion Williamson scored 28 points, CJ McCollum added 25 and the New Orleans Pelicans held off the Milwaukee Bucks 107-100. Jonas Valanciunas had 17 points and 10 rebounds for New Orleans, giving him his 32nd double-double of the season, but just his first in 11 games. Trey Murphy III had 15 points and 11 rebounds for the Pelicans, who won despite going just 8 of 32 on 3-pointers and shooting just 39.6% overall. Giannis Antetokounmpo had 35 points and 14 rebounds for Milwaukee. Damian Lillard scored 20 for the Bucks, as did Malik Beasley, who hit six 3s. Milwaukee lost its second straight after falling to the Los Angeles Lakers in overtime in their previous game.
